Tromman Bridge
Tromman Bridge is a bridge in County Meath, Leinster. Tromman Bridge is situated nearby to the village Rathmolyon, as well as near the hamlet Agher.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Rathmolyon is a village in the southern portion of County Meath, Ireland, situated 8 km south of Trim. It is situated at the junction of the R156 regional road and the R159 regional road connecting Trim to Enfield. Rathmolyon is situated 3 km east of Tromman Bridge.

Agher is a crossroads and townland in County Meath, Ireland. It is located 3 km southwest of Summerhill. Agher is in a civil parish of the same name and in the barony of Deece Upper. Agher is situated 7 km southeast of Tromman Bridge.

Longwood, historically called Moydervy, is a village in southwest County Meath, Ireland. It is located about 15 km south of the town of Trim on the R160 regional road. Longwood is situated 7 km southwest of Tromman Bridge.
